Altaf Bukhari, a prominent political figure in Jammu and Kashmir, has voiced concerns over the entrenched influence of political dynasties in the region. Speaking to KNS, Bukhari criticized these longstanding power structures for hindering progress and development. He argued that the dominance of certain families has stifled opportunities for new leadership and fresh ideas, which are crucial for the region's advancement.
Bukhari's remarks come at a time when there is a growing demand for political reform and greater representation of diverse voices in Jammu and Kashmir. He emphasized the need for grassroots change, suggesting that the current political landscape is heavily skewed in favor of a select few. This, he believes, has resulted in policies that do not adequately address the needs of the general populace, thereby stalling meaningful development.
Highlighting the importance of inclusivity, Bukhari called for a shift in the political narrative to prioritize the aspirations of ordinary citizens over familial legacies. By advocating for a more equitable political environment, he hopes to pave the way for a future where leadership is determined by merit and vision rather than lineage. His statements resonate with a broader call for democratization and transparency in the region's governance.
